There are some sources that mention the use of Mirage V on loan from Egypt during the Iran-Iraq-War. The V is an export variant of the Mirage III. Thus the decal option is not completely wrong.

In 1986 eight egyptian Mirage V SDR were transfered to the IrAF for a five week trial period. My sources say that they were also flown by iraqi pilots from time to time.
